The Hang Seng closed almost flat at 24,911 on Wednesday after dipping slightly in morning deals. Traders digested comments from President Trump, who said the U.S. was close to a trade deal with China and that he would meet President Xi before year-end if an agreement is reached. Investors also looked ahead to key Chinese economic data, including trade figures on Thursday and inflation on Saturday, amid concerns over rising trade barriers and persistent deflation risks. The S&P 500 slid in a head-spinning session for traders as they grappled with new tariffs proposed by President Donald Trump that were in flux throughout most of Tuesday. The trade policy uncertainty has brought the benchmark to the brink of a correction, which is defined as a decline of 10% from its high. The S&P 500 ended the session 0.76% lower, falling to 5,572.07. At its low of Tuesday's session, the index was 10% below its record close. European stock markets closed lower on Tuesday, sharply extending losses as trade tensions between the U.S. and Canada escalated. After a negative start to the week for global equities as U.S. growth fears weighed, the pan-European Stoxx 600 ended Tuesday down by another 1.7%. Milan-listed shares of Jeep and Dodge owner Stellantis fell 5%, with the Stoxx Autos index down 2.13%, after U.S. President Donald Trump threatened to hike tariffs on cars coming into the U.S. from Canada. The Dow Jones Industrial Average (DJIA) shed further weight on Tuesday, dropping nearly 700 points on the day, or 1.76% after United States (US) President Donald Trump vowed to heat up his own trade war with Canada. President Trump took to his Truth Social account early Tuesday, informing his social media followers that he's instructed his Secretary of Commerce to impose an additional 25% tariff on all Canadian steel and aluminum exports to the US, bringing the new total to 50% on all Canadian metals. The Dow Jones Industrial Average fell on Tuesday after President Donald Trump imposed additional tariffs on Canadian steel and aluminum entering the U.S. The 30-stock average fell 565 points, or 1.4%, while the S&P 500 fell 1%. The Nasdaq Composite slipped 0.6%. In a Truth Social post, Trump said tariffs on steel and aluminum would double to 50% from 25%, effective Wednesday. It was the latest in a series of escalating trade policy moves that have stoked fears of a U.S. economic recession. European markets opened lower on Tuesday as global markets slumped amid concerns that the U.S. economy will suffer from President Donald Trump's trade tariffs. The pan-European Stoxx 600 index fell about 0.2% shortly after the opening bell, with the U.K.'s FTSE 100 down 0.2%, while France's CAC 40 gained 0.3% and Germany's DAX added 0.2%. The travel and leisure sectors led the losses. Health care stocks were also in negative territory, after Danish pharmaceutical giant Novo Nordisk's latest weight-loss drug trial results.
